About 33 Ashover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

33 Ashover Road is a mid-terrace house in Leicester (LE5 5HB). It has a recorded floor area of 105 m² (around 1130 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(February 2016) shows a D (score 59),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in June 2013 the rating was G, the property has climbed 3 bands since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good; while lighting d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from February 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Today's modelled estimate of £262,000 sits 101.5% above the 2014 sale of £130,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£115/sq ft) was about 164.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On the market in January 2014 and unlisted since — roughly 12 years.
